Thunderbird needs change for dictionary transition

Bug #590452 reported by Chris Cheney
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
thunderbird (Ubuntu)
Fix Released
High
Micah Gersten

Bug Description

Binary package hint: thunderbird

Thunderbird in Ubuntu needs support for the dictionary transition that happened in Debian last year. I told several people about this issue on IRC and at UDS but it seems to have not been fixed yet and may have been forgotten so I am filing this bug now. I am not sure if Thunderbird has basis in any packaging in Debian but if so then a general merge of other fixes may be needed as well. I know Debian doesn't have a 'Thunderbird' package as such but does have an unbranded version.

The fix appears to be changing these lines:

rules: dh_link usr/share/myspell/dicts $(DEBIAN_TB_DIR)/dictionaries
thunderbird.postinst.in:SYS_DICTIONARY_DIR=/usr/share/myspell/dicts

to

rules: dh_link usr/share/hunspell $(DEBIAN_TB_DIR)/dictionaries
thunderbird.postinst.in:SYS_DICTIONARY_DIR=/usr/share/hunspell

It looks like it might need to check on upgrades and switch the symlink as well, but I am not certain.

Thanks,

Chris Cheney

Chris Cheney (ccheney)
Changed in thunderbird (Ubuntu):
importance: Undecided → High
milestone: none → maverick-alpha-2
status: New → Triaged
Revision history for this message
Micah Gersten (micahg) wrote :

Taking this.

Changed in thunderbird (Ubuntu):
assignee: nobody → Micah Gersten (micahg)
milestone: maverick-alpha-2 → maverick-alpha-3
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package thunderbird - 3.0.6+build2+nobinonly-0ubuntu1

---------------
thunderbird (3.0.6+build2+nobinonly-0ubuntu1) maverick; urgency=low

  * New upstream release v3.0.6 (THUNDERBIRD_3_0_6_BUILD2)
    - see USN-958-1

  [ Chris Coulson <email address hidden> ]
  * Fix LP: #600217 - StartupWMClass value in thunderbird.desktop file is
    not correct
    - update debian/thunderbird.desktop

  [ Micah Gersten <email address hidden> ]
  * Fix LP: #590452 - Thunderbird needs change for dictionary transition;
    Use hunspell dictionaries for Maverick and later
    - update debian/rules
  * Fix LP: #569762 - Thunderbird's .desktop file does not contain russian
    translation; Thanks to Igor Zubarev for the translation
    - update debian/thunderbird.desktop
  * Fix LP: #563535 - thunderbird -g fails due to invoking "$LIBDIR/$META_NAME"
    instead of "$LIBDIR/$META_NAME"-bin
    - update debian/thunderbird.sh.in
  * Fix LP: #411691 - many Exception... "update.locale file doesn't exist" in
    console
    - update debian/rules
 -- Micah Gersten <email address hidden> Tue, 13 Jul 2010 08:59:50 -0500

Changed in thunderbird (Ubuntu):
status: Triaged → Fix Released
Changed in thunderbird (Ubuntu):
status: Fix Released → Fix Committed
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.